And, though he loved the girl after his fashion, he desired to wound her by no such vile proposal.

He did not wish to live a life of sin, if such life might be avoided.

If he made his proposal, it would be but for her sake; or rather that he might show her that he did not wish to cast her aside.

It was by asserting to himself that for her sake he would relinquish his own rank, were that possible, that he attempted to relieve his own conscience.

But, in the mean time, she was in his arms talking about their joint future home! "Where do you think of living ?" asked Mrs.O'Hara in a tone which shewed plainly the anxiety with which she asked the question.
"Probably abroad," he said.
"But mother may go with us ?" The girl felt that the tension of his arm was relaxed, and she knew that all was not well with him.
